[ASDisplayNode] Don't force a layout pass on a visible node that enters preload state #751

After #706, a layout pass is forced on an ASM-enabled node that enters preload state to make sure that its subnodes can start preloading as well. However, when the node is visible, a (coalesced, thus more efficient) layout pass will be triggered by CA soon anyways, so rely on it instead.

…nters preload state (#779)

This reverts commit 2e98588 (#751).

The reason we can't wait for the coming CA's layout pass is that cell node visibility events occur before the pass, at which time the cell's subnodes don't have correct frames for impression tracking.

The root cause of this problem is that, right now, cell node visible states are set by ASRangeController well before the layout pass of the hosting collection/table view. That means we're "jumping the gun". The more I think about this, the more I agree with @Adlai-Holler that we need to treat visible state differently. That is, a node should only be visible (and thus get visibility events) after it's fully loaded, it's view/layer attached to the hierarchy and laid out by a CA transaction. In other words, at the end of the CA layout pass. Such change needs time and effort to be thoroughly reviewed and tested. Until then, let's roll with this fix.
